The2021 Castagna La Chiave Sangiovese is a vibrant cool-climate Sangiovese from Beechworth, Victoria, crafted from organically and biodynamically grown fruit. Inspired by the classic expressions of Tuscany while reflecting its Australian origin, the 2021 vintage opens with aromas of sour cherry, wild raspberry and red plum, layered with dried herbs, violet, earthy spice and subtle savoury notes. The wine captures the variety's natural brightness and regional character with precision and balance.
On the palate, it is medium-bodied with fine, chalky tannins, lively natural acidity and an elegant, finely structured texture. Flavours of red cherry, cranberry and blood orange are complemented by hints of dried herbs, subtle spice and gentle oak, leading to a long, savoury finish with excellent freshness. The vibrant acidity and restrained fruit profile make this a classic food-friendly expression of Sangiovese.
